FAForever Forums
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Login
    The current pre-release of the client ("pioneer" in the version) is only compatible to itself. So you can only play with other testers. Please be aware!

    413 Payload Too Large from POST https://api.faforever.com/mods/upload

    Scheduled Pinned Locked Moved FAF support (client and account issues)
    22 Posts 10 Posters 1.5k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• JipJ Offline
      Jip
      last edited by Jip

      We can't only keep the latest version - it would break all replays that use* a previous version.

      If you want to test your mod with a select couple of people it is better to share the mod manually instead of uploading gigabytes worth of data to the server.

      A work of art is never finished, merely abandoned

      D C 2 Replies Last reply Reply Quote 1
      • ZLOZ Offline
        ZLO
        last edited by

        Can we come back to this? They can't solve the problem.
        We need a clearer understanding of what the problem exactly is.
        And what can be done.
        and if they need to decrease the file size then how much it needs to be decreased?
        They have tried 307MB (before compression). that is ~50% mod size decrease and it does not let them upload the file.
        also tested 100MB (before compression) and it lets them upload the mod, but they can't decrease mod size this much.
        When talking about file size limits pls mention if it is before or after compression pls.

        TA4Life: "At the very least we are not slaves to the UI" | http://www.youtube.com/user/dimatularus | http://www.twitch.tv/zlo_rd

        JipJ 1 Reply Last reply Reply Quote 0
        • D Online
          Defiant @Jip
          last edited by

          @Jip said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

          We can't only keep the latest version - it would break all replays that use* a previous version.

          If you want to test your mod with a select couple of people it is better to share the mod manually instead of uploading gigabytes worth of data to the server.

          This is important to myself and others who VERY MUCH enjoy watching older replays.

          1 Reply Last reply Reply Quote 0
          • JipJ Offline
            Jip @ZLO
            last edited by

            @ZLO said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

            Can we come back to this? They can't solve the problem.
            We need a clearer understanding of what the problem exactly is.
            And what can be done.
            and if they need to decrease the file size then how much it needs to be decreased?
            They have tried 307MB (before compression). that is ~50% mod size decrease and it does not let them upload the file.
            also tested 100MB (before compression) and it lets them upload the mod, but they can't decrease mod size this much.
            When talking about file size limits pls mention if it is before or after compression pls.

            What is the mod about?

            If it is a unit mod then you can split them over several, smaller mods. You would need to enable them all manually of course, but it would be the easiest approach.

            A work of art is never finished, merely abandoned

            ZLOZ 1 Reply Last reply Reply Quote 0
            • ZLOZ Offline
              ZLO @Jip
              last edited by

              @Jip said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

              @ZLO said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

              Can we come back to this? They can't solve the problem.
              We need a clearer understanding of what the problem exactly is.
              And what can be done.
              and if they need to decrease the file size then how much it needs to be decreased?
              They have tried 307MB (before compression). that is ~50% mod size decrease and it does not let them upload the file.
              also tested 100MB (before compression) and it lets them upload the mod, but they can't decrease mod size this much.
              When talking about file size limits pls mention if it is before or after compression pls.

              What is the mod about?

              If it is a unit mod then you can split them over several, smaller mods. You would need to enable them all manually of course, but it would be the easiest approach.

              Yes, it is a unit mod.

              Okay that is one possible solution...
              But splitting to like 6 smaller mods is pretty annoying

              Ideal would be to fix something on the server, we just don't understand how is that possible that we were able to upload 600mb mod before and now we can't, while file size limit did not get changed for 4 years, and halving the mod size does not help

              TA4Life: "At the very least we are not slaves to the UI" | http://www.youtube.com/user/dimatularus | http://www.twitch.tv/zlo_rd

              ZLOZ 1 Reply Last reply Reply Quote 0
              • Brutus5000B Offline
                Brutus5000 FAF Server Admin
                last edited by

                It would be helpful if the author could upload the current folder zipped to a Google drive or somewhere.

                He said, "I've been to the year 3000
                Not much has changed, but they live underwater
                And your great-great-great-granddaughter
                Is playin' FAF, playin' FAF"

                1 Reply Last reply Reply Quote 0
                • nullptrN Offline
                  nullptr
                  last edited by

                  The best solution will be splitting mod assets and code, so code can be changed frequently without involving reupload or assets

                  “Be a yardstick of quality. Some people aren’t used to an environment where excellence is expected.”
                  — Steve Jobs.
                  My UI Mods
                  Support me

                  1 Reply Last reply Reply Quote 0
                  • ZLOZ Offline
                    ZLO @ZLO
                    last edited by

                    @Brutus5000 said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

                    It would be helpful if the author could upload the current folder zipped to a Google drive or somewhere.

                    https://disk.yandex.ru/d/7krrkoNgsaG-5w updated mod that they could not upload. Size did not increase compared to previous version.
                    https://disk.yandex.ru/d/UbzdKvyZCFm2Ig same mod but split into two parts and also failed to upload

                    TA4Life: "At the very least we are not slaves to the UI" | http://www.youtube.com/user/dimatularus | http://www.twitch.tv/zlo_rd

                    1 Reply Last reply Reply Quote 0
                    • ZLOZ Offline
                      ZLO
                      last edited by

                      any ideas why ~330 mb one is failing to upload? (is it gettnig bigger after it gets uploaded? :D)

                      TA4Life: "At the very least we are not slaves to the UI" | http://www.youtube.com/user/dimatularus | http://www.twitch.tv/zlo_rd

                      1 Reply Last reply Reply Quote 0
                      • Brutus5000B Offline
                        Brutus5000 FAF Server Admin
                        last edited by

                        I can reproduce the error on the test server with the upload. But so far I can not see the cause of it.

                        He said, "I've been to the year 3000
                        Not much has changed, but they live underwater
                        And your great-great-great-granddaughter
                        Is playin' FAF, playin' FAF"

                        1 Reply Last reply Reply Quote 0
                        • C Offline
                          Caliber @Jip
                          last edited by

                          @Jip said in 413 Payload Too Large from POST https://api.faforever.com/mods/upload:

                          We can't only keep the latest version - it would break all replays that use* a previous version.

                          How much value is placed on modded replays?

                          I see many many standard rated games that have desynced replays and it doesnt create much of an issue, from what I see.

                          If a creator wants the previous versions removed, and it saves a lot of space on the server, I dont see a huge reason not to.

                          A 1 Reply Last reply Reply Quote 0
                          • Brutus5000B Offline
                            Brutus5000 FAF Server Admin
                            last edited by

                            I have some very bad news. As it turns out Cloudflare is limiting uploads to 100mb in our Pro plan. Even upgrading to Business plan would slighlty increase it to 200mb. Only enterprise customers can have 500mb uploads or more.

                            Unfortunately we have to hide our servers behind Cloudflare Proxies due to the DDoS issues. So for now, we cannot offer any solution to the problem. Sorry.

                            He said, "I've been to the year 3000
                            Not much has changed, but they live underwater
                            And your great-great-great-granddaughter
                            Is playin' FAF, playin' FAF"

                            1 Reply Last reply Reply Quote 1
                            • A Offline
                              Argon_Praim @Caliber
                              last edited by

                              Is it possible to let the client indicate the number of parts of the mod archive to the server, if he, for example, splits the original archive into X parts, adjusted for size?

                              1 Reply Last reply Reply Quote 0
                              • Brutus5000B Offline
                                Brutus5000 FAF Server Admin
                                last edited by

                                No. There are alternate options, but we have to develop them first.

                                He said, "I've been to the year 3000
                                Not much has changed, but they live underwater
                                And your great-great-great-granddaughter
                                Is playin' FAF, playin' FAF"

                                1 Reply Last reply Reply Quote 0

                                Hello! It looks like you're interested in this conversation, but you don't have an account yet.

                                Getting fed up of having to scroll through the same posts each visit? When you register for an account, you'll always come back to exactly where you were before, and choose to be notified of new replies (either via email, or push notification). You'll also be able to save bookmarks and upvote posts to show your appreciation to other community members.

                                With your input, this post could be even better 💗

                                Register Login
                                • First post
                                  Last post